Our response

 

Please be aware at the time your request was made, 24^th September 2023,
data for the 2023/24 academic year was unavailable as it was still being
collected. Under the Act we can only provide information up to the date we
receive the request. However, you are welcome to resubmit your request in
order to receive the most recent data now that it is avaliable.

 

1. The number of interview offers that non-contextual students from the UK
were given?

2. The number of offers that non-contextual students from the UK received?

 

The table below provides details relevant to your request. Please consider
the notices in red when analysing the data.

 

Invited to interview Offers
2021 215 86
2022 145 83

 

Please Note:

Data presented for the 2021 and 2022 UCAS cycles.

We have taken non-contextual to refer to applicants who did not receive
adjustment to their ranking score as a result of widening participation
factors.
